1969 Supreme(Online)(AP) 7

ANDHRA PRADESH HIGH COURT
XYZ, J
Shabir Hussain N. v. Forest Range Officer Dorka


Advocates:
For the Appellants/Petitioners: Sri E. Ayyapu Reddy
For the Respondents: Public Prosecutor

1. Petitioners have been convicted by the Judicial Second Class Magistrate, Markapur in C. C. No. 735 of 1965, under S.35 and S.36 of the Andhra Pradesh Forest Act read with R.10 of the Timber Transit Rules and sentenced to pay a fine of Rs. 200-00, Rs. 100-00 and Rs. 100-00 respectively, in default to suffer simple imprisonment for seven days. The trial Court also ordered confiscation of the forest produce which was seized from the accused by the forest authorities. On appeal, the Additional Sessions Judge, Kurnool confirmed the conviction and sentence. Hence, this revision.

2. The case for the prosecution is as follows :
That on 24-8-1965 at about 1 A.M., at Dornal at the junction of Kurnool - Guntur and Srisailam road, the accused were found illicitly transporting green teak, roughly dressed M.Os. 1 to 394 by a lorry A. P. Q. 2245, without a valid permit, that A - 1, who claimed to be the owner of the forest goods, showed a permit Ex. P - 1 to P.W. 1, the Forest Range Officer, Dornal and P.Ws. 2 and 3 the Tahsildar and Forest Guard, Pedda Manthala, when questioned about the illicit transport; that Ex.
